#0f022c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0f022c is composed of 5.9% red, 0.8% green and 17.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 65.9% cyan, 95.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 82.7% black. It has a hue angle of 258.6 degrees, a saturation of 91.3% and a lightness of 9%. #0f022c color hex could be obtained by blending #1e0458 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000033.

● #0f022c color description : Very dark (mostly black) violet.
#0f022c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#0f022c has RGB values of R:15, G:2, B:44 and CMYK values of C:0.66, M:0.95, Y:0, K:0.83. Its decimal value is 983596.

Shades and Tints of #0f022c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020006 is the darkest color, while #f6f3f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#0f022c
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#161519 is the less saturated color, while #0e002e is the most saturated one.
